Question 1086898: What is the next fraction in this sequence? Simplify your answer.
1/72, 1/36, 1/18, 1/9

this is a geometric sequence
if we first term multiply by 2, we will get second term
%281%2F72%292=2%2F72=1%2F36...do same with second term to get third term
%281%2F36%292=2%2F36=1%2F18,
%281%2F18%292=2%2F18=1%2F9
